Which component is NOT part of an airplane's pressurization system?

The pitot tube is not part of an airplane's pressurization system. Instead, it serves a different purpose related to measuring airspeed and providing critical data for navigation and performance calculations. The pitot tube measures the dynamic pressure of the air, which helps determine how fast the aircraft is moving through the air, and is essential for the operation of the airspeed indicator.

In contrast, the other components listed are integral to the functioning of the pressurization system. The cabin pressure regulator controls the pressure within the cabin to keep it within a safe and comfortable range for passengers and crew. The source of air, typically provided by the engines or an auxiliary power unit, supplies the necessary air to maintain cabin pressure. The outflow valve regulates the amount of air that leaves the cabin, thus playing a crucial role in managing the pressure levels during flight.

Understanding the distinct functions of these components helps clarify why the pitot tube, while important for flight safety and performance, does not belong to the pressurization system.
